How can landscape design help with yard drainage problems in Pittsburgh?
Our landscape design services specifically address Pittsburgh's common drainage issues by creating strategic grading plans, installing proper drainage systems like French drains or dry creek beds, and selecting plants that thrive in our local soil conditions. We design landscapes that direct water away from foundations and prevent pooling, protecting your property from water damage.

What makes your approach to landscape design different for Pittsburgh homeowners?
We focus on creating designs that work with Pittsburgh's specific challenges—including our clay-heavy soils, hilly terrain, and seasonal rainfall patterns. Rather than just creating beautiful spaces, we design landscapes that solve practical problems like drainage and irrigation issues from the start, saving homeowners from costly repairs down the road.
